Pool Drainage Engineering in Santa Rosa County

Pool installations in Santa Rosa County require PE-stamped drainage plans because the added impervious surface changes your property’s stormwater characteristics. Northwest Florida Water Management District and local building departments require engineering documentation before issuing pool permits.

Santa Rosa County Regulations & Permits

Santa Rosa County falls under Northwest Florida Water Management District (NWFWMD) jurisdiction, which uses Statewide standards (Chapter 62-330) criteria for drainage design. Permit processing typically takes Variable, with fees ranging from $0 (self-cert) to $14,000. Santa Rosa County has its own drainage ordinance with specific requirements including ldc ordinance 2021-13 under revision. Frequently Asked Questions

Pool Drainage Engineering in Santa Rosa County — FAQ

Pool drainage engineering in Santa Rosa County typically costs $1,000–$2,500 for PE-stamped drainage plans. This includes stormwater calculations, grading plans, and permit coordination. The total project cost including installation ranges from $3,000–$8,000. Pool contractors typically factor drainage engineering into their overall project budget.
Pool installations in Santa Rosa County almost always require drainage engineering as part of the building permit application. Northwest Florida Water Management District requires stormwater documentation for the added impervious surface. PE-stamped drainage plans showing pre-development vs. post-development runoff are typically required. CivilSmart coordinates all drainage permits as part of our pool drainage service.
